Hyperbaric Oxygen Healing Environment

Hyperbaric oxygen therapy is a medical method that uses pure oxygen in a pressurized chamber
It helps the body absorb more oxygen than normal breathing allows
This increase in oxygen supports natural healing processes in tissues and organs
Patients enter a controlled chamber where air pressure is higher than standard atmospheric pressure
This environment allows oxygen to dissolve into blood plasma more effectively
The therapy is often used for conditions that require improved oxygen delivery
It supports recovery in wounds that heal slowly and in tissues with low oxygen supply
The process is supervised by trained medical professionals for safety and effectiveness
It is widely used in hospitals

Deep Tissue Oxygen Saturation Science
The science behind hyperbaric oxygen therapy focuses on oxygen saturation in body tissues
Increased pressure allows oxygen to reach deeper layers of skin muscles and bone
This process enhances cellular energy production and improves tissue repair speed
Oxygen under pressure dissolves directly into plasma without relying only on red blood cells
This mechanism improves circulation in damaged or inflamed areas of the body
It helps reduce swelling and supports immune response in affected tissues
Researchers study how oxygen levels influence healing at the cellular level
The therapy is based on well established physiological principles of gas behavior under pressure

Medical Applications and Treatment Areas
Hyperbaric oxygen therapy is used for a variety of medical conditions
It is commonly applied in wound care for diabetic ulcers and infections
It assists in treating decompression sickness in divers
It is also used for carbon monoxide poisoning cases

Recovery Support and Patient Experience
Patients undergoing hyperbaric oxygen therapy often experience gradual improvements in health
The increased oxygen supply supports tissue regeneration and reduces inflammation
Many patients report improved energy levels after several sessions
The therapy sessions are typically scheduled over multiple weeks
Each session lasts a controlled amount of time inside the chamber
Patients may feel mild pressure changes in ears similar to airplane travel
Medical staff monitor patients throughout the entire procedure
Comfort and safety are prioritized during each treatment session

Safety Protocols and Clinical Monitoring
Hyperbaric oxygen therapy is generally considered safe when performed correctly
However it requires careful patient screening before treatment begins
Medical teams assess medical history and current health status
Continuous monitoring ensures pressure levels remain within safe limits
Special equipment is used to control oxygen concentration inside the chamber
Side effects are rare but may include ear discomfort or fatigue
Emergency protocols are in place for patient protection
The therapy is conducted by trained healthcare professionals in controlled environments
